How much do hoa assistant community manager jobs pay per hour?

As of Jul 26, 2026, the average hourly pay for hoa assistant community manager in the United States is $20.96,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$18.27 and $22.12 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What does an HOA Assistant Community Manager do?

An HOA Assistant Community Manager supports the Community Manager in overseeing the daily operations of a homeowners association (HOA). Their responsibilities often include communicating with homeowners, coordinating maintenance and repairs, assisting with budgeting and financial reports, organizing community events, and ensuring community rules and regulations are followed. They act as a liaison between residents, vendors, and the board, helping ensure smooth community operations. This role requires strong organizational, communication, and problem-solving skills.

Job description

Pittsburgh based Real Estate Services Company looking for a qualified Assistant Community Manager for a high-end condominium and homeowner community interested in growth and advancement.  Work with a team of professionals committed to quality and excellence in customer service.  
 
Qualifications:
  • Self-motivated individual with strong commitment to responsive, client focused professionalism.
  • Strong project management skills and the ability to maintain professional relationships with a variety of stakeholders.
  • Proficient in Microsoft Word and Excel; Experience with Yardi Property Management software a plus
  • Demonstrated ability to handle a variety of assignments simultaneously
  • Excellent communication, organizational, verbal, written and presentations skills
  • Timeliness, attention to detail and organization
  • Available after hours as needed basis to respond to emergencies
Primary Duties:  
  • Interact with contractors, clients, and residents, ensuring maintenance, projects, and daily operations are carried out effectively and to specification. 
  • Administer HOA website
  • Perform weekly common area and property inspections for maintenance issues
  • Responsive to homeowners with questions and concerns.  
  • Assist with budget development, adherence to budget, working with the Community Manager.
  • General administrative and community management support to Senior Community Manager including delinquency tracking and notices, vendor contracting, violation tracking, and project approvals
  • Vendor management and invoice approval
  • Inventory replenishment and tracking
